An object is placed in front of a spherical mirror at a
distance of 20 cm from it. A virtual image is formed at a
distance of 30 cm from it. Arrange the following steps
in the proper sequence to determine the nature and
focal length of the mirror.
Answers
Answer:
(a) Assign proper signs to the object distance and image distance by using the sign convention.
(b) Substitute the values of v and u in the mirror formula
(c) Obtain the value of focal length.
(d) Check whether the focal length obtained is negative or a positive integer.
(e) Decide whether the mirror is a convex or a concave mirror based on the sign of the focal length obtained.
Initially proper sign is assigned to object distance and the image distance according to the sign convention.The values of u and v are substituted in the mirror formula
The sign of f indicates whetherthe mirror used is convex or concave.
